Konjac root is an additional name for glucomannan, the fiber produced from the foundation from the konjac plant that grows primarily in Asia. According to the Drugs.com site, konjac root has been used in a number of forms being a treatment for many medical conditions, including as being a means for stimulating and maintaining fat loss. After consumption, the basis displays properties inside the gastrointestinal system that, supporters of glucomannan use claim, can inexpensively control hunger and decrease calorie intake. However, glucomannan me is linked to several potentially serious unwanted side effects, and it is use has been frozen in several countries.
Features.
Konjac root - also known as konjac fiber and konjac mannon, in addition to glucomannan - is derived from the Amorphophallus konjac plant roots and consists of polysaccharide chains that can't be absorbed through the gastrointestinal system. Konjac root is marketed in four main forms: as a dietary supplement, in meal-replacement drinks, in noodles-often called konjac, shiritaki or yam noodles-and in the dried flake form, meant to be sprinkled on food.

Function.
In line with the Wall Street Journal, scientific researchers believe the health benefits of konjac root are due the fiber's capacity to dissolve and swell in the water in the digestive system, forming a thick solution that slows the speed of digestion as well as the absorption of both fat and carbohydrates. It can be belief that the existence of this thick solution in the intestines promotes a sense of fullness, decreases appetite and may inhibit cholesterol absorption.

Disadvantages.
More scientific studies are needed before the fat loss connection between using konjac root might be labeled an excellent long-term weight reduction strategy. The Wall Street Journal reports that many researchers are nevertheless uncertain whether or not the potential benefits to glucomannan supplementation are really linked to the root or, instead, are simply the consequence of increasing the amount of fibers in the diet. Konjac root use has been related to mild unwanted effects, for example diarrhea, gas and abdominal pain; however, it's also linked to choking incidents and digestive system blockages if plenty water aren't consumed with konjac root tablets. Because of this risk, glucomannan-containing supplements are banned in many countries, including Australia. Diabetics are strongly recommended to avoid while using supplements without direct medical supervision simply because they may cause hypoglycemia.
